Kalki's breakthrough role came with the 2009 film "Dev.D," where she played the character of Chanda, a loose and bold woman. Her performance earned her critical acclaim and several awards, including the Filmfare Award for Best Supporting Actress. This marked a turning point in her career, leading to more significant roles in films like "Khatta Meetha" (2010), "Zindagi Na Milegi Dobara" (2011), and "Rockstar" (2011).
